The myth behind the Award, The Man behind the Myth.
People ask why I don't call myself a Slayer Sword Winner? The answer is.. I didn't win a coveted Slayer Sword, I won something even better.. The Slayer Plaque!
A plaque? you ask? Yup a plaque. In 1995 which was my second year competing in the Golden Demons in Baltimore, I was awarded a Gold first place award for my Warhammer Fantasy large monster entry, a Empire Gray Wizard on a Hippogriff. It was that model which won me the Coveted Overall Slayer award. In 1995 GW US decided to not award a sword, but..the Plaque. I'm not sure what exactly it's made of, But I know its quite heavy and it is Silver plated. It even has a cool Space Wolf theme.
Today it hangs proudly on my wall in my painting room.
